May 4th, Solskjaer, who is currently coaching Besiktas in the Turkish Super League, was interviewed by the BBC and talked about his old club Manchester United and his former disciples.
Talking about Manchester United
"Manchester United is my home, always a part of my life. In football, you won't regret anyone, because we are absolutely 100% lucky to be able to play for such a club. But for me, it's hard to see Manchester United now because it's my family struggling. Every weekend when I look at the standings, I always feel very heavy."
Talking about choosing Besiktas after a long unemployment "You haven't been here for a long time, so I don't know, the club is great, I've talked to many clubs before, but I didn't accept it. This is the only one Home is a club that I would like to say 'I wish I could coach' after chatting, because they have great potential. You can feel that their identity and culture are very compatible with me, their values are about being honest and working for the community, they have a very similar atmosphere to Manchester United, and here it reminds me of Manchester United. Talk on coaching status
"Everyone knows that you need time to build a team you want, and you have to do what you want, not just let the team do what you want. Some things I hope my team can do it but it can't do it yet. We are in a financial hardship period. We spent some money, but maybe it wasn't that smart. Signing is probably the most important thing in football. You need to have the right structure and introduce the right players. When the roster you manage is selected by two or five different coaches, it's hard to integrate them into the team you want. Success requires continuity and patience, but few people can do it."
